Vazquez Roofing Inc
Closed today
“Francisco and Michael have been great with their team. They listened to any concerns I had in the quoting process and very flexible with requests.“
“Francisco and Michael have been great with their team. They listened to any concerns I had in the quoting process and very flexible with requests.“